Bug List: (This bug is not in your last search results)   Show last search results      Search page      Enter new bug
Bug#: 182056
Alias:
Product:
Component:
Status: RESOLVED
Resolution: FIXED
Assigned To: Gentoo Science Related Packages <sci@gentoo.org>
Hardware:
OS:
Version:
Priority:
Severity:
Reporter: Jukka Ruohonen <drear@iki.fi>
Add CC:
CC:
Remove selected CCs
URL:
Summary:
Status Whiteboard:
Keywords:

Filename Description Type Creator Created Size Actions
epix-emacs.patch patch to add Emacs support and activate bash-completion patch Christian Faulhammer 2007-06-25 07:37 0000 1.49 KB Details | Diff
50epix-gentoo.el site file, to go to ${FILESDIR} text/plain Christian Faulhammer 2007-06-25 07:39 0000 298 bytes Details
epix-emacs.patch patch to add Emacs support text/plain Christian Faulhammer 2007-09-10 17:47 0000 1.29 KB Details
Create a New Attachment (proposed patch, testcase, etc.) View All

Bug 182056 depends on: Show dependency tree
Bug 182056 blocks: 184166
Votes: 0    Show votes for this bug    Vote for this bug

Additional Comments: (this is where you put emerge --info)


Not eligible to see or edit group visibility for this bug.






View Bug Activity   |   Format For Printing   |   XML   |   Clone This Bug


Description:   Opened: 2007-06-14 20:35 0000
After installing the great epix-1.0.24 for the first time, I noticed that the
Jay Belanger's major mode for editing ePiX files with emacs gets installed into
/usr/share/doc/epix-1.0.24/config/epix.el. 

Thus, it would be nice if we would have emacs-capability with an USE flag.

------- Comment #1 From Christian Faulhammer 2007-06-25 07:37:33 0000 -------
Created an attachment (id=123024) [details]
patch to add Emacs support and activate bash-completion

Here is a patch that will add optional Emacs support and optional installation
of bash-completion.  Site file will follow.

------- Comment #2 From Christian Faulhammer 2007-06-25 07:39:33 0000 -------
Created an attachment (id=123025) [details]
site file, to go to ${FILESDIR}

This will autoload the elisp files when needed

------- Comment #3 From Christian Faulhammer 2007-09-09 14:17:45 0000 -------
Dear sci team, when bumping, please add us to your prayers and fix the emacs
support, everything is here in form of patches.  Thanks.

------- Comment #4 From Markus Dittrich 2007-09-10 10:53:48 0000 -------
Hi Christian,

Since I don't use emacs, could you please let me know if
these patches work smoothly with epix 1.1.15 which is
now in portage. If so, I'd gladly add it to the ebuild.

Thanks much for the good emacs work.

cheers,
Markus

------- Comment #5 From Christian Faulhammer 2007-09-10 17:02:14 0000 -------
(In reply to comment #4)
> Since I don't use emacs,

 You are doing badly wrong here. :)

> could you please let me know if
> these patches work smoothly with epix 1.1.15 which is
> now in portage. If so, I'd gladly add it to the ebuild.

 No, it won't work.  I will prepare a new patch, Emacs support has been changed
a lot. 

> Thanks much for the good emacs work.

 That's just team work.

> cheers,
> Markus

 Christian

------- Comment #6 From Christian Faulhammer 2007-09-10 17:47:00 0000 -------
Created an attachment (id=130523) [details]
patch to add Emacs support

Ok, bash_completion is gone.  I exchanged a generic make call by emake, it
worked here, so maybe you tend to add it.

------- Comment #7 From Markus Dittrich 2007-09-11 01:34:24 0000 -------
(In reply to comment #6)
 > Ok, bash_completion is gone.  I exchanged a generic make call by emake, it
> worked here, so maybe you tend to add it.
> 

Thanks much - I just commited the patch to cvs.
It seems though that emacs is already needed
during the compile itself, so should virtual/emacs
rather go into DEPEND?

Thanks,
Markus

------- Comment #8 From Christian Faulhammer 2007-09-11 06:00:14 0000 -------
(In reply to comment #7)
> (In reply to comment #6)
>  > Ok, bash_completion is gone.  I exchanged a generic make call by emake, it
> > worked here, so maybe you tend to add it.
> > 
> Thanks much - I just commited the patch to cvs.
> It seems though that emacs is already needed
> during the compile itself, so should virtual/emacs
> rather go into DEPEND?

 You are right.

------- Comment #9 From Markus Dittrich 2007-09-11 13:34:38 0000 -------
Thanks, I've changed the ebuild accordingly.

------- Comment #10 From Jukka Ruohonen 2007-09-13 07:34:14 0000 -------
Hi, thanks for your efforts. 

Unfortunately, as you probably noticed, the USE="emacs" fails; see bug #192283.

Bug List: (This bug is not in your last search results)   Show last search results      Search page      Enter new bug